TPHA ++?

I've been treated for syphilis last 2008. this 2012 i decided to go abroad and i passed the interview then proceed to medical, unfortunately i've been traced to be tpha positive, what am i going to do next.?

do you recall the exact result?

some folks do stay positive for a lifetime. the way we determine if it's a newly acquired infection again with syphilis is through serial testing and comparing the values of the results.
